Letterkenny’s John Kennedy awarded Freedom of the City of London

written by Rachel McLaughlin January 23, 2025
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

Letterkenny man John Kennedy has joined a prestigious list of people to be awarded the Freedom of the City of London.

The Rahan native, who works as a Partnerships Manager with Equals Money PLC, celebrated the honour in November.

The honour was bestowed during a special Freedom ceremony held at the Guildhall’s Chamberlain’s Court. 

John was joined by his proud parents, Cyril and Doreen Kennedy, along with family, friends, and colleagues.

John Michael Kennedy of Willesden, London celebrates receiving the Freedom of the City of London on 14th November 2024

John has been living and working in London for the past nine years, where he has forged strong connections with the wider Irish business community.

His father, Cyril, also spent a significant portion of his life working in London.

Looking back on the occasion, John said he was “truly honoured”.

“It was a great day celebrating with close friends and family, with a special thanks to David O’Reilly and former Lord Mayor Vincent Keaveny CBE for their nominations.”

Other Donegal recipients of the Freedom of the City of London include Frosses businessman Tim Kelly, Islington Councillor Troy Gallagher, and playwright and theatre director Rosalind Scanlon.
